Why Choose an Electric Tool Set?
Electric tool sets deal many advantages to both amateur DIY enthusiasts and professional tradespeople. Here are a couple of factors to think about investing in one:
- Efficiency: Electric tools enable users to finish tasks quicker than manual tools.
- Accuracy: These tools frequently offer much better control and consistency in efficiency.
- Versatility: Electric tool sets usually included a range of tools that can handle a vast array of tasks.
- Reduced Strain: Using electric tools reduces the physical exertion required, minimizing tiredness and the threat of injury.
Kinds Of Electric Tools
Electric tool sets frequently include a variety of tools that accommodate various functions. Here’s a breakdown of some important types:

1. Power Drills
- Used for drilling holes and driving screws into various products.
- Corded vs Cordless: Cordless drills use mobility, while corded drills offer consistent power.
2. Saws
- Reciprocating Saws: Ideal for demolition and rough cuts.
- Circular Saws: Used for straight cuts in wood and other materials.
- Jigsaws: Perfect for detailed cuts.
3. Sanding Tools
- For smoothing surfaces and preparing products for finishing.
- Alternatives include belt sanders, orbital sanders, and detail sanders.
4. Effect Wrenches
- Excellent for tightening or loosening up nuts and bolts quickly, frequently used in automobile work.
5. Angle Grinders
- Used for cutting, grinding, and polishing different surfaces, ideal for metal and concrete tasks.
6. Multi-Tools
- Flexible tools that combine functions of several tools into one, typically fantastic for smaller jobs.
Features to Consider When Choosing an Electric Tool Set
When selecting an electric tool set, there are numerous crucial functions to consider:
- Power Source: Determine if you choose corded tools (usually more effective) or cordless tools (more portable).
- Battery Life: For cordless alternatives, think about the battery’s charge capacity and schedule of spares.
- Weight and Size: Heavier tools might use more power; however, they can cause fatigue.
- Ergonomics: An ergonomic style makes sure comfort throughout extended usage.
- Included Accessories: Some sets include additional devices, such as drill bits and blades, which includes value.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How do I pick an electric tool set for my needs?
- Determine the projects you prepare on tackling, think about the size and intricacy, and assess which tools will be most advantageous.
2. Are corded tools much better than cordless tools?
- Corded tools typically provide continuous power and can be more powerful, while cordless tools use benefit and portability. It ultimately depends on the user’s requirements.
3. What maintenance do electric tools require?
- Basic upkeep includes regular cleansing, examining electrical cables, and charging batteries as needed. Particular tools may have their own requirements.
4. Can I utilize electric tools for DIY home jobs?
- Definitely! Electric tools can make home enhancement tasks simpler and more enjoyable. It’s crucial to understand the tools you are using to make sure safety and effectiveness.
5. How do I guarantee security when using electric tools?
- Always wear appropriate security equipment, disconnect power when changing attachments, and follow the producer’s guidelines.
